DVDAnswers reports that Alien vs Predator will be coming out on Blueray in the US on 23rd January 2007. The disc will have an anamorphic widescreen presentation as well as a 5.1 DTS HD Lossless Audio track. Any special features are unknown. Retail price will be about $40. Here's the artwork:

A very short interview has appeared on YouTube and GoogleVideo with James Cameron. The interviewer asks him if he'll make Alien 5. Cameron says he's tempted because "they really screwed up the whole franchise [with AvP]". His opinion has changed somewhat from when he was interviewed in February about it. IESB.net recently had an interview with Fox chairman, Tom Rothman. He confirms AvP2 will be rated R and that the film will be a lot like Aliens. He also says there is talk of a future Predator 3 movie as well as Alien 5.
